Louis-Marthe de Gouy d\' Arsy

Louis-Marthe, marquis de Gouy d' Arsy (or of Arcy) is an officer French born the July 15th 1753 and dead guillotine the July 23rd 1794 after judgment of a revolutionary tribunal following the Conspiration of the prisons.

States of service

  • 1768 : Musketeer in the second company of Its Majesty
  • 1770: Lieutenant with the regiment of Besancon of the royal artillery body
  • 1774: Captain ordering the regiment of the Queen, dragons
  • 1782: Mestre of camp as a second of the regiment of the cuirassiers of the king
  • 1783: Captain reformed with the regiment of dragons of the Queen
  • 1786: Admitted knight of Saint-Louis
  • 1789: Colonel with the 2nd regiment of cuirassiers of the King
  • July 26th 1791: Colonel of the 6th regiment of dragons
  • February 6th 1792: Brigadier general
He was general lieutenant, in survival of his father Louis de Gouy d' Arsy , in the government of the Ile de France at the department of Vexin. In 1788 he is knight of Saint-Louis, large baillif of sword of the baillages of Melun and Moret and administrator of the Water-company of Paris. With the elections of 1789, he is elected appointed of Santo Domingo to the General states. Frank mason (Cabin of Frankness) with the East of Paris, he was the assistant of the duke of Chartres, then large Master.
